With 46 and has blitzed the least amount of times in the conference (gary said like 74 times or something going into tonight) Thats incredible. Sack numbers in previous years under Saban

2014- 31 in 14 games
2013- 22 in 13 games
2012- 35 in 14 games
2011- 30 in 13 games
2010- 27 in 13 games
2009- 31 in 14 games
2008- 25 in 14 games
2007- 25 in 13 games
